A Comprehensive Guide to CEH Training and Certification in Triangle, VA

The CEH training and certification process in Triangle, VA, typically involves attending a course that covers a range of topics, including ethical hacking and penetration testing. The course can be taken in a classroom or online setting and lasts for around five days. Participants are expected to have a basic understanding of networking and security concepts before enrolling in the course.

After completing the course, participants must sit for an exam to obtain the CEH certification. The exam is a four-hour multiple-choice test that assesses the participant’s knowledge of ethical hacking concepts, tools, and techniques. Participants must score at least 70% to pass the exam and obtain their certification.

What to Expect from a CEH Training Course in Triangle, VA

CEH training courses in Triangle, VA, are designed to provide participants with hands-on experience in identifying and addressing vulnerabilities in an organization’s security systems. The course covers a range of topics, including denial of service attacks, network scanning, system hacking, and social engineering.

Participants will also have access to tools and programs commonly used by hackers, such as the Metasploit framework. The course emphasizes the importance of using these tools ethically and responsibly, and participants are required to sign an agreement before using any of the tools provided in the course.

In addition to the technical skills covered in the course, participants will also learn about the legal and ethical considerations surrounding cybersecurity. The course covers topics such as intellectual property rights, privacy laws, and the consequences of cybercrime.

Common Misconceptions About CEH Training and Certification

There are several misconceptions about CEH training and certification that need to be addressed. One common misconception is that ethical hacking is illegal. In reality, ethical hackers work under a strict code of ethics and are required to obtain permission before performing any security testing.

Another misconception is that CEH courses are geared towards hackers or cybersecurity professionals only. In reality, CEH courses are open to anyone with a basic understanding of networking and security concepts and an interest in cybersecurity.
